UNPKG

mission.api

Version:
11 lines 496 B
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); const vendor_1 = require("../vendor"); const router = vendor_1.GetRouter(); exports.SetFilterMiddleware = router; router.use((req, res, next) => { const method = req.headers['x-http-method-override']; Object.defineProperty(req, 'filter', { get: () => typeof method === 'string' && method.toUpperCase() === 'GET' ? req.body : req.query }); return next(); }); //# sourceMappingURL=set-filter-middleware.js.map